Chester Allstars under 11s were in giant-killing form when they travelled to Manchester City’s multi million pound Etihad Academy Complex.

They defeated City’s u11s 4-2 thanks to a superb hat-trick from the impressive Joe Walters and one from Josh Watkin late on.

The Chester-based squad, made up from the best youngsters from the city’s primary schools, have been playing and training together as one elite squad since September, notching up some impressive performances along the way.

Head coach Sean Johnson said: “Their belief and attitude grew throughout the game. This was their best performance yet.”

The Allstars will soon defend their ESFA North West Champions Cup against Liverpool Schools FA and, in March, will represent Cheshire in the ESFA North England finals.
